Assembly Supervisor
EmersonAbout the role
If you are front line Supervisor Lead looking for an opportunity to grow, Emerson has an exciting opportunity for you! Based in our Mansfield, MA location, you will be responsible for the supervision and leadership of our union hourly Valve Assembly Department. You will be accountable for managing the day-to-day operations to enhance production while improving our safe workplace, reducing costs, improving quality, and meeting customer requirements.
In This Role, Your Responsibilities Will Be:
- Promote the Safety culture as our number one priority. Establish safe and productive work environment through positive reinforcement of safety policies, hazard identifications, and continuous improvement initiatives.
- Be involved in our Safety audits and committees as well as 5s activities.
- Develop the daily work schedule and assign employees to areas of the department based on workload.
- Ensure all documentation is clear and legible i.e., test reports, paint reports, etc.
- Ensure closing-out of operational steps on routings.
- Maintain and evaluate employee training/maintain employee qualifications. Identify training gaps or additional qualifications needed.
- Develop standard methodologies and detail new and tribal knowledge.
- Areas of direct responsibility- Nuclear VA (valve assembly), Navy VA, Large VA, sand blast, and paint and steam testing.
- Follow and abide by our Union agreement contract and support/communicate with all supervisors for consistent messaging.
- Assist in making equipment and staffing decisions to support long-term business levels.
- Periodically evaluate group and individual performance through both formal and informal reviews.
- Support cross training for all team members based on business needs.
- Lead problem solving activities of any issue related to Valve assembly and supporting departments.
